Skip to content

Commit

Permalink
Merge branch 'master' into remove-validatingstorageadapter
Browse files Browse the repository at this point in the history
  • Loading branch information
scottaubrey committed Oct 22, 2024
2 parents f26f463 + 70d2c55 commit 542fdc0
Show file tree
Hide file tree
Showing 23 changed files with 1,720 additions and 1,128 deletions.
1 change: 1 addition & 0 deletions .dockerignore
Original file line number Diff line number Diff line change
Expand Up @@ -5,3 +5,4 @@
/var/
/vendor/
!.gitkeep
/.phpunit.result.cache
30 changes: 30 additions & 0 deletions .github/workflows/update-api-sdk.yaml
Original file line number Diff line number Diff line change
@@ -0,0 +1,30 @@
name: Create PR to update api-sdk dependency to latest
on:
workflow_dispatch:
schedule:
- cron: '0 4 * * 1'

jobs:
update-api-dummy: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4

- name: Check for api-sdk updates
run: |
docker compose run --no-deps setup composer install
docker compose run --no-deps setup composer update 'elife/api', 'elife/api-client' 'elife/api-sdk' --with-dependencies --no-suggest --no-interaction
- id: get-api-sdk-version
run: echo api-sdk-version=$(jq -r '.packages[]|select(.name == "elife/api-sdk").source.reference' < composer.lock) >> $GITHUB_OUTPUT


- name: Create Pull Request
uses: peter-evans/create-pull-request@v7
with:
add-paths: composer.lock
commit-message: Update api-sdk to ${{ steps.get-api-sdk-version.outputs.api-sdk-version }}
branch: update-api-sdk
title: Update api-sdk to ${{ steps.get-api-sdk-version.outputs.api-sdk-version }}
body: |
Update the api-sdk dependency to the ${{ steps.get-api-sdk-version.outputs.api-sdk-version }}
1 change: 1 addition &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-6,3 +6,4 @@
/var/
/vendor/
!.gitkeep
/.phpunit.result.cache
26 changes: 13 additions & 13 deletions composer.json
Original file line number Diff line number Diff line change
Expand Up @@ -21,32 +21,32 @@
"elife/api": "^2.30",
"elife/api-client": "dev-master",
"elife/api-problem": "^1.1",
"elife/api-sdk": "dev-master",
"elife/api-sdk": "^1.0@dev",
"elife/api-validator": "dev-master",
"elife/bus-sdk": "dev-master",
"elife/content-negotiator": "^1.0",
"elife/content-negotiator": "^1.0.3",
"elife/logging-sdk": "^1.0@dev",
"elife/ping": "^1.0",
"elife/ping": "^1.0.1",
"guzzlehttp/guzzle": "^6.3",
"jms/serializer": "^1.5@dev",
"justinrainbow/json-schema": "^5.1",
"mindplay/composer-locator": "^2.1",
"monolog/monolog": "^1.22",
"silex/silex": "^2.0",
"symfony/console": "4.2.12",
"symfony/event-dispatcher": "^3.2",
"symfony/finder": "5.4.17",
"symfony/monolog-bridge": "^3.2",
"silex/silex": "^2.3",
"symfony/console": "4.4.49",
"symfony/finder": "5.4.43",
"symfony/monolog-bridge": "^4.4",
"symfony/psr-http-message-bridge": "^1.0",
"willdurand/negotiation": "^2.3",
"symfony/yaml": "^4.4",
"willdurand/negotiation": "^3.1",
"nyholm/psr7": "^1.1"
},
"require-dev": {
"mockery/mockery": "^0.9.5",
"phpunit/phpunit": "^5.5",
"mockery/mockery": "^1.0",
"phpunit/phpunit": "^7.5",
"squizlabs/php_codesniffer": "^3.5",
"symfony/browser-kit": "^3.1",
"symfony/var-dumper": "^3.1"
"symfony/browser-kit": "^4.4",
"symfony/var-dumper": "^4.4"
},
"config": {
"sort-packages": true,
Expand Down
Loading

0 comments on commit 542fdc0

Please sign in to comment.